### Changelog — CrashFunnel v4.2

The setting formerly called `CF_UPLOAD_TOKEN_OLD` has been renamed to reflect that it now authorizes the entire Delverton symbolication pipeline, not just uploads. Deployments still referencing the old name will fail at boot with a clear error. Update your env files accordingly; the renamed secret-setting line goes immediately after this sentence.

sealed setting: RELAY_SECRET5=82864

Subject: Handover — Ledgerline partitioning

Hi Varek,

Before my leave, confirming the monthly partitioning scheme on the orders_archive table in Ledgerline. Partitions rotate on the first of each month; the detach job runs under the maintenance role only. Please verify grants carefully before the review. The replica you should validate against is reachable via the following connection string.

replica DSN, kajep-yahag: mssql://praok_svc:iF@db-8d68.plorvaio.local:5432/eliion

Subject: Blueprints for the Ormsby Lane Permit

Dear Dispatch Desk,

The full blueprint set for the Ormsby Lane building permit is rolled, tubed, and sealed with our stamp. These are the originals the planning office requires, so please confirm the tube seal is unbroken before release. Collection is scheduled for tomorrow at ten. The courier hand-over instruction is stated below.

handover note for bajog-tawig: the lamion quenael courier leaves the wendor ledger at gate 1289 under passcode 760784

Validator plugin registry fails to load third-party rules after hot reload.** On-call: Checkwright's plugin loader caches the registry at startup; a hot reload rebuilds the core validators but silently drops any externally registered plugins, so records pass validation that should fail. Impact is limited to tenants using custom rules. Mitigation: restart the validation workers rather than hot-reloading until the fix lands. Do not roll back — the previous release has the same flaw. The affected deployment corresponds to the build token below.

trace token, fafog-kageg: htk4_98e6